‘Accountability Still Missing for 1984 Sikh Massacre’

By Tricitynews Reporter
Chandigarh 05th November:- A Special Investigation Team (SIT) formed by the central government must not waste the opportunity to deliver justice for the 1984 Sikh massacre, said Amnesty International India today at the Chandigarh launch of a campaign digest on the massacre.
Titled “32 years and waiting: An era of injustice for the 1984 Sikh massacre’’, the campaign digest outlines the cover up that followed the massacre and the status of various official investigations over the last 32 years. The digest also carries personal accounts of survivors.
The Delhi police had closed investigations into hundreds of cases after the massacre, citing a lack of evidence. A special investigation team (SIT) constituted by the central government in January 2015 to re-investigate cases related to the massacre, has made slow progress. In November, it had identified 58 cases for reinvestigation.
Sanam Sutirath Wazir, Campaigner at Amnesty International India, said that the SIT raised hopes among victims and survivors that they would finally get justice. But the SIT’s apparent lack of transparency so far has been disturbing.
The SIT has the authority to file charges against accused persons where there is sufficient available evidence. It was originally given six months to complete this exercise, but received extensions in August 2015 and August 2016. It is now slated to complete its investigation in February 2017, two years after it was set up.
In June 2016, Amnesty International India and a range of prominent activists, journalists, lawyers and political leaders made a series of recommendations related to effective investigation, comprehensive reparations and legal reforms, to be submitted to the Ministry of Home affairs.
Since November 2014, over 600,000 people, most of them from Punjab have supported Amnesty International India’s campaign demanding justice for the victims of the massacre.
A short film on the life of Darshan Kaur, a survivor of the massacre, was also screened at the event. Darshan Kaur, who was 21 years old during the violence, lost her husband and 12 relatives.


National Institute of Nursing Education Holds Lamp Lighting Ceremony

By Tricitynews Reporter
Chandigarh 05th November:- The Lamp lighting ceremony was held at National Institute of Nursing Education (NINE) Auditorium for the Student Nurses admitted for session 2016 on 5th December, 2016. Dr. Sandhya Ghai, Principal, NINE cum-Presidents, TNAI of the UT Branch, Chandigarh welcomed the Chief Guest Prof. Subhash Verma, Director, PGI, and the Guest of Honor, Prof. Meenu Singh, Deptt. of Pead. Medicine and Head, Telemedicine Centre, PGI. Dr. Ghai congratulated the students for choosing the noblest of the noble profession & their formal entry into nursing profession. She also highlighted the importance of lamp lighting ceremony & taking Florence Nightingale Pledge. She encouraged the new entrants for providing selfless service to the patients with empathy and maintains dignity of self and the profession. She motivated them to provide quality cost effective evidence based comprehensive nursing care to the patients. Prof.  Subhash Verma, congratulated the new entrants for their entry into nursing profession and insisted on putting tremendous energy and hard work towards patient care with full dedication. He wished them success for future endeavors.  While addressing to the students, Dr. Meenu Singh, who also had been Prof. Incharge NINE in 2010, urged them to serve the patients as competent and compassionate nurses. She further emphasized on dedication and honesty to be incorporated in patient care.  
Florence Nightingale pledge was sworn in by Dr Sunita Sharma, Advisor, Student Nurses Association. The  programme concluded with the candle lighting ceremony by  the Chief Guest and the Guest of Honor alongwith the Principal, NINE and the senior faculty members, in which each student lit candle as a symbol of enlightenment & hope for their bright future.

Second Annual Pediatric Endocrinology Meet at Advanced Pediatrics Center PGI

By Tricitynews Reporter
Chandigarh 05th November:- The 2nd Annual Pediatric Endocrinology Update was organized by the Department of Pediatrics at the Advanced Pediatric Center, PGI, Chandigarh. About 80 delegates from all over the country participated in this meeting. Prof. Meenu Singh inaugurated the CME. Eminent endocrinologists, pediatricians and pediatric endocrinologists including Prof. Anil Bhansali, Prof. Jayashree M, Prof. Indu Verma, Dr. Rama Walia, Dr Rakesh Kumar and Dr Harvinder Kaur from PGI, Dr. Muralidharan from Fortis hospital, Mohali, Dr Senthil Senniappan from Liverpool, UK, Dr Raja Padidela from Manchester, UK and Dr Carles Gaston-Massuet from London, UK deliberated on disorders of glucose metabolism in children. Dr. Devi Dayal, the organizing secretary said that the focus of this CME, the second of the annual series, was Diabetes and Hypoglycemia. The participants felt that the prevalence of diabetes in India has increased tremendously in the past decade and concerted efforts from governments and medical fraternity are required to stem this rise.

On this occasion, the recently formed society named as “ACT for Diabetes”, largely managed by parents of children with Type 1 Diabetes was launched. The aim of this society is to financially help children with diabetes from low income families and to provide platforms for advocacy of rights of these children.

Kher Writes to Jaitely:Demands Film Institute for Chandigarh

By Tricitynews Reporter
Chandigarh 05th November:- Kirron Kher, Member of Parliament has demanded a Film Institute for Chandigarh. In a letter written to Union Minister of Finance Arun Jaitely, Kirron Kher has requested him to grant a Film Institute to Chandigarh in the upcoming Budget Session. In her letter she has mentioned that Chandigarh is a city of educational institutions and the entire Northern Indian Belt is devoid of any institute that would teach and skill young aspirants in the craft of film making. She has further written that Chandigarh caters from Punjab, Haryana,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, Bihar and Uttar-Pradesh. The film industry in Punjab is thriving and yet people who apply to FTII in Pune don’t get admission as the seats are limited. Some great talent never realizes its potential as it cannot get the requisite training. 
It may be mentioned that Kirron Kher has been saying that she is trying to bring a hi-tech Film Institute in Chandigarh ever since she got elected as Member of Parliament. She had said that Chandigarh has tremendous untapped potential as a Film Institute to cater to the Punjabi and Bollywood film industry. Presently, the directors have to go all the way to Mumbai to get sound mixing, editing, dubbing, special effects and other processes done to get the final output. So, If we have a full fledged film institute in Chandigarh, it would save the directors from a lot of transportation costs and booking troubles. Further, it will boost Chandigarh`s economy by creating huge employment as also will bring Chandigarh on national and global map as a preferred filming and shooting destination.

SAD+BJP Will Form Govt. For Third Time :Majithia

By Tricitynews Reporter
Chandigarh 05th November:- SAD+BJP will form govt for the third time in state with full majority as a result of cooperation and public support because Punjab govt. has always worked for each and every cadre of society. This was stated by revenue and rehabilitation minister and minister for information and public relation Bikram Singh Majithia while addressing the press at forest complex. Bikram Singh Majitjia was present here during the formal taking over of charge as chairman Punjab Christian welfare boars by sr. Amandeep Gill. He said that Christian welfare board will be a blessing for the Christians of Punjab.
Bikram Singh during this congratulated the newly appointed chairman  Amandeep Gill and said he will work with dedication and will meet the expectation a of Christian community. He said that present govt. has done multifaceted development of state and has ensured basic facilities for all in the state. Addressing a question on law and or elder in the state he said no body is allowed to create any disturbance in law and order.
Addressing the recent matter regarding murder of orchestra dancer kulwinder kaur in aashirvad resort at Maur Bathinda, he expressed his grief and said that use of arms is strictly prohibited in resorts during functions but still it happens. He said that case has been filed under section 302 and defaulters will be prosecuted. Addressing a question of law and order and system in the state he said congress party has always betrayed the general public. The Congress party starts any agenda for the sake of his own benefit. But now public is aware and in the coming election they will show the true face of congress.
Bikram Singh said that coming election will be based on development agendas. Public of Punjab needs development only. During this newly appointed chairman Punjab Christian welfare board Amandeep Gill supariwind said that he will perform his duty with dedication and will meet the expectations of Christian community in Punjab. He said that problems being faced by Christian community will be given first priority.
